Plan the format and moderation rules before you invite guests
Start by defining the frame: length, segmenting, turn-taking, and what counts as off-limits. For heated fandom topics, set explicit expectations and consequences. Publish a simple Code of Conduct and require guest acknowledgment.
Format template (example)
- Intro (3–5 mins): host sets context, rules, and safe phrasing guidelines.
- Panel discussion (30–45 mins): moderated segments with timed turns.
- Audience Q&A (15–20 mins): curated questions from pre-submitted and live chat.
- Closing (3–5 mins): safe wrap-up and resources for escalation or appeals.
Moderation policy essentials
- No doxxing, harassment, threats, or hateful slurs — immediate mute/ban.
- Designated escalation “quiet room” for guests if conversation becomes hostile.
- Proactive trigger warnings for spoilers, sensitive content, and strong language.
- Transparent appeals: note how decisions are made and by whom.

Tech stack — choose a reliable core in 2026
Keep the stack simple but redundant. In 2026, AI moderation assists but doesn’t replace human judgment — and remote audio quality can still fail. The core stack below balances accessibility and professional results.
Hardware
- Interface: Focusrite Scarlett series for budget creators; RME Babyface or Universal Audio Apollo for low-latency work and DSP options.
- Mics: Dynamic for noisy rooms (Shure SM7B, Electro-Voice RE20); condensers (AKG, Rode NT1) for quiet studio setups.
- Headphones: Closed-back (Sennheiser HD280, Beyerdynamic DT 770) for monitoring and avoiding bleed.
- Mixer or AV switcher: Rodecaster Pro for small teams; Allen & Heath or GoXLR for multi-operator events.
- Backup connectivity: LTE hotspot and second ISP where feasible.
Software & platforms
- Streaming: OBS Studio (custom scenes & NDI), StreamYard for browser simplicity, or vMix for pro control.
- Remote guests & recording: Riverside.fm, Cleanfeed, and SquadCast (all offer multi-track remote recording). For lowest-latency two-way conversations, use NDI-based workflows or SRT where supported.
- Audio routing: Loopback (macOS), VoiceMeeter (Windows), or Dante Via for networked audio routing.
- Moderation & chat: Streamlabs/StreamElements for overlays; CrowdControl and platform AutoMod plus 2026 AI moderation agents for triage.
- Clip & highlight tools: Descript for fast edit + AI summarization, and dedicated clipping on YouTube/Twitch.
Detailed audio routing workflows
Below are three common routing scenarios and the exact signal flows you can implement with common tools.
1) Host + 1 remote guest (single operator)
- Host mic -> audio interface -> DAW/OBS input (local monitoring via headphone mix).
- Guest joins via Riverside or Cleanfeed (use multi-track recording enabled). Send guest audio to OBS via virtual audio cable / Loopback as a discrete track.
- Return feed to guest: program mix (host + other audio) with latency compensation disabled for monitoring; use direct monitoring on host interface to avoid echo.
- Record separate tracks: host mic, guest remote track, output mix. This supports post-event cleanup and clips.
2) Host + 3+ remote guests (moderation + multi-track)
- Use a dedicated USB/Thunderbolt interface with >= 4 inputs or a small mixer that provides multichannel USB outputs.
- Guests connect via Riverside/SquadCast — each guest’s recording is captured locally and uploaded automatically (redundancy).
- Route each remote guest to its own OBS source using virtual audio channels or NDI over local LAN for quality and lower CPU load.
- Assign an operator to control on-air status (mute/unmute) and a second operator to monitor audio levels and clip production.
3) In-studio panel + remote audience call-ins
- Local mics feed a hardware mixer with dedicated subgrouping for the stream mix and room PA.
- Use a separate bus for call-ins; route calls through a Gate/Compressor and a human moderator to the program feed.
- Enable a 7–10 second broadcast delay for live call screening (useful for heated conversations).
Remote guest onboarding and redundancy
Guests are the fragile part of the chain. Give them clear instructions and fail-safes.
Pre-show guest checklist
- Send a technical runbook with required speeds (min 10 Mbps up/5 Mbps down recommended for HD remote video), mic & headphone requirements, and a link to a test room.
- Ask guests to use a wired Ethernet connection where possible.
- Require local recording: guests record their own mic track (phone voice memo is better than nothing). Riverside and SquadCast automate this, but ask for local backup.
- Collect a short bio and one spoiler-sensitive note so you can moderate comments about content safely.
During the show
- Have a standby guest or a quick re-route plan in case someone drops out.
- Use a separate private Discord or Zoom channel for host-to-producer communication to coordinate muting and question selection.
- If audio degrades, pull remote guest audio offline and play their pre-recorded answer (if prepared), then return when stable.
Audience Q&A: curation, tech and escalation
Heated fandom panels often explode in the chat. A good Q&A workflow increases signal-to-noise and reduces harassment.
Pre-submitted and live combo
- Open pre-submissions 48–72 hours in advance using Google Forms or Typeform. Tag each submission (spoiler/no-spoiler, on-topic/off-topic).
- During the show, route live chat through a moderator dashboard (StreamElements or Streamlabs) and surface top questions to the host via private Slack/Discord.
- Use time codes and labels so editors can later clip answers quickly.
Real-time moderation tools (2026 update)
- Combine platform AutoMod with a tuned AI moderation agent that flags doxxing, impersonation and coordinated brigading (these are common issues post-2025).
- Use profanity filters and automated penalty tiers (warning > temporary mute > ban).
- Enable a broadcast delay and have a moderator with a “kill switch” to remove audio/video if necessary.
Moderation team roles & training
Assign clear responsibilities — who enforces chat, who handles tech, who supports guests. Train moderators ahead of time on de-escalation and platform tools.
Core roles
- Lead Moderator: final decision-maker for bans and escalations.
- Chat Mod(s): triage live chat flags and escalate to lead.
- Guest Liaison: private channel contact for guests during the show.
- Tech Operator: audio levels, scene switching, and backups.
- Legal/Safety Contact: pre-identified person to advise on potential defamation or legal threats.
Moderator scripts and de-escalation
- Create short scripts for common actions (e.g., temporary mute message, ban message, appeal process message).
- Train mods on language: use neutral phrasing, avoid escalating language, and prioritize community safety.
Handling AI risks and deepfakes in 2026
By 2026, real-time voice cloning and deepfake video are mainstream enough to be a risk in high-profile fandom discussions. Prepare:
- Require guest backups (local recordings) that you can verify post-show if someone disputes an audio clip.
- Use watermarking/metadata on your recorded streams and save raw track archives for 90 days.
- Have a response plan for deepfake distribution: take down requests, transparent forensic steps, and a public statement template.
Rehearsal and show-day checklist
Run a full tech rehearsal 24–48 hours before the live panel. Walk through every worst-case scenario and confirm backups.
24–48 hours out
- Confirm guests have local backups and test recordings.
- Publish Code of Conduct publicly and remind registered attendees.
- Check ISP redundancy and hotspot access.
1 hour before
- Start a private producer-only room for last-minute coordination.
- Test audio/video one more time, and verify chat moderation filters are on.
- Enable broadcast delay if you’ll take live calls or expect extreme reactions.
During the show
- Keep a rolling Google Doc for notes, timestamps, and issues.
- Moderators should post public reminders of rules every 10–15 minutes during highly charged segments.
Post-event: wrap, moderation logs and repurposing assets
After the live event, the work continues. Archive everything, produce clarity, and repurpose content for growth and revenue.
- Save raw audio/video tracks for at least 90 days. Label files with timestamps and participant names.
- Export a moderation log: actions taken, reasons, and appeal outcomes.
- Create short clips: 30–90 second clips with highlights and context. Use AI summarization to produce TL;DRs and social captions.
- Turn moderated contentious exchanges into educational clips about community standards — transparency builds trust.
Case example: Running a panel on the Jan 2026 Star Wars slate
Imagine a panel about the new Filoni-era slate announced Jan 2026 — you will face spoilers, passionate takes, and coordinated reactions. Apply the playbook:
- Pre-submit spoiler-heavy questions and label them as spoilers; schedule a spoiler-only segment after audience consent is confirmed.
- Assign one moderator to watch coordinated brigading signs (rapid accounts posting similar replies) and another to manage the guest liaison channel.
- Use a 10-second delay and clip highlight markers so any inciting statements can be removed from the stream if needed.
